kachiz:
The year was 2013, I was on industrial training, attached to an Engineering firm in Lekki.

My lunch throughout my attachment period revolved around Gala and La-Casera, Coke or Sprite. I never dared to eat from any of the very few canteens in the site area because there was every likelihood of purging.

So this particular afternoon after our lunch break, the chief Foreman of the company kept on with stories about a certain Calabar lady that dished him his lunch. About how wonderful her cooking prowess was, he went on and on about this Calabar lady.

So because the reviews of this lady were too much, the Engineer I was working under decided that we go and check her out towards the close of work.
We left the site and trekked to the canteen at some minutes to 4 O'Clock. We checked her out and one thing led to another, plastic chairs and tables were carried out, we sat down and my superiors declared the floor open for the bottles of Beer that was now before us.
For some very uncanny reasons, for some very mysterious reasons, I went ahead to drink on an empty stomach. My breakfast that morning was tea and I skipped my usual lunch that day.

Because I was drinking on an empty belly, I got tipsy after the first bottle of Star. Then I needed to impress the people I was with, I needed to show them I could drink like a man, so I stretched out my hand and accepted the second bottle as soon as the option was made available to me.
After the first round of drinks, the foreman with us got angry at nobody and started saying stuff that he wasn't supposed to be saying on a very normal day. To be sincere, I was surprised.

How could just one bottle make him start ticking?
Who knew I was next in line to tick.

I stood up to go and urinate after I had gulped down half of the content in the second bottle and I felt what Neil Armstrong must have felt after he stepped out from his space shuttle. I was levitating.

Who took my legs?

I staggered to and returned back to my seat after doing what I had gone to do.

The Engineer smiled, I am sure he must have noticed that he was now two men short from a company of three. I refused to go another round after I finished my second bottle.

Getting drunk two hours away from home was one thing, the other part was getting home in one piece.

That's the difficult part.

The Engineer offered that I could come crash at his house if I couldn't make it home by myself.
I told him I will be fine.

How could I have agreed? There was FIFA13 at home that was waiting for my arrival. Even, my reputation was at stake.

The engineer entered a bike and off he rode towards his house. He lived not too far from the site in the Igbeafor area of Lekki.
I was now left with the chief foreman, we boarded a bike together and went towards the junction where we would board a bus.

In the midst of my drunkenness lay a fear.
The fear of crossing over the Lekki-Epe expressway.

On a daily basis, people who were in full control of their senses get knocked down on this road and here was I without my senses with someone who entered the ecstasy state before me trying to cross the road.

For a long while before this day, I had forgotten what a guardian angel meant. If guardian Angels used mobile phones, his battery would have died from my calls and text messages.

Till this day, how we walked across more than 15meters of paved asphalt and no vehicle even came as close as screeching for our sake is still a mystery to me.

This particular act of ours qualified us to get featured in an episode of "A thousand ways to die".

I parted ways with the Foreman, entered the bus that was heading straight to C.M.S park, bent down my head and slept off instantly like someone that was sedated. If the driver and the rest of the passengers had decided to change their mind and drive us to Abeokuta that night, I would have been the last person to revolt after we must have reached the destination.

If you've ever been to C.M.S Park, you'll notice that there is a portion of the wall that has "DO NOT URINATE HERE" written in almost all the languages of the world. Motherfvckers even had it engraved in Braille.

You will have to be a dead person for you to disobey this warning.

I have witnessed twice what happens to the unlucky people who decided to go that wall to urinate.
The first was a nice looking guy that was dressed on suit, he was still doing his thing when this huge Ape looking, Macho, like man dragged him away from behind. Even the Jews during WW2 were never dragged like that in their concentration camps.

It wasn't the embarrassment that was the issue, I am sure the Ape-like man must have forcefully taken away some of the other man’s prized possessions.
The second was an old man who could pass as my grandfather. After he pleaded and pleaded to the Ape-like guy that the last money on him was for his transportation home, he took his watch and still collected the money.....

The green and white bus that had me in it roared to a stop as we entered Ajah park, the time now was some minutes to 8 pm. 8 pm or even 8:30 pm at C.M.S park looked 11 am in most eastern states. I came down and crossed over to C.M.S Park.

Then it happened........

My bladder beeped...

I needed to Pee!

I needed to urinate.

My next ride was from C.M.S to Aguda Surulere through Eko bridge axis, because of the free nature of the traffic system of Lagos, a journey of less than 30mins will be clocking around 2hours. But I needed to pee and my only option was on that "wall".

I had 700naira with me. One 200naira note and one 500naira note. I separated the money. #200 for my ride home and #500 in the case the universe decided to turn the tides against me.

The kind of morale I had at this moment would have been able to make me stop bullets if someone tried shooting at me.

I walked towards the wall and stopped some inches away from where all the warning was boldly written. I unzipped my Jeans, brought out my other self and released the chains that were keeping me in bondage. Upon all the morale I claimed I had, I expected someone to come from behind and slap the two bottles of beer out of my head.

I finished urinating, zipped up and turned around. Nothing happened. So I quietly walked to the bus, paid, sat down and slept off immediately. I didn’t know when the bus got filled up or even when it drove off from the park, the vehicle passed my bus-stop and took me to the last bus-stop which was Kpako-Aguda.

Bikes charge as much 100naira from this place but who enters bike when he still has a leg?

The conductor had to shout before I woke up, I was the only left inside. He asked me if I wanted to sleep in his bus.

Immediately I stepped down, all the contents in my stomach surged up immediately towards my mouth. They wanted to be free and so I allowed them. I opened my mouth and damaged the surrounding ground with my internally generated waste. I felt better and walked gradually back home to like a ghost that was looking for someone to possess.

After what seem an d like eternity, I found the house. Opened the gate, climbed upstairs and fell down on the bed.

No one knew what transpired and why I didn't bother to ask for night food that day.

It was after some days that I narrated to them my story.

...The End.

Jexyme:
Pls don't confuse yourself and others.

Medical laboratory technician and med. Lab. Assistant are diploma and certificate programs run by schools of health and technology. When you graduate, you'll work in the hospital in different cadre with and as a subordinate to Medical Laboratory Scientist. You'll be helping in some preanalytical procedures and some postanalytical procedures and other duties as may be assigned to you by a medical laboratory scientist.

A medical laboratory scientist is someone who has undergone Bachelor of medical laboratory science (B.MLS) program in an accredited university. The program is at least five years and it's divided into two phases, the preclinical and clinical phases. In preclinical phase, you offer courses such as basic sciences in year one while in year two, you'll offer human anatomy, physiology and medical biochemistry in most schools alongside MBBS, BDS, Pharmacy, Physiotherapy and Radiography students. In the clinical phase, you'll offer Histology, histochemistry, chemical pathology, Haematology, transfusion science, medical microbiology, clinical immunology among other clinical courses.
When you graduate with B.MLS you'll be given provisional licence which will enable you undergo one year compulsory internship program (before NYSC) after which permanent licence will be issued.
Finally, Med lab scienctist is at par in terms of cadre (essential clinical staff), work entry point (CONHESS 9/2) and work promotion progression (up to Director) with pharmacist, physiotherapist, and medical radiographer in federal civil service. While in the Academics (University Lecturing), the entry point is Assistant Lecturer.
